Rangendingen, a region situated at the foot of the Swabian Alb in Germany, offers a varied landscape for outdoor activities. The area is characterized by gentle hills, dense forests, and scenic river valleys like the Starzeltal. Its natural setting, including proximity to the Upper Danube Nature Park, provides a foundation for several sports like touring cycling, hiking, mountain biking, road cycling, and more.

Rangendingen is characterized by gentle hills, dense forests, and its proximity to the Upper Danube Nature Park. Notable landmarks include Hohenburg Castle, Zeller Horn viewpoint with views of Hohenzollern Castle, the Starzeltal, and Stausee Rangendingen (reservoir).
